  1. Asian criteria of abdominal obesity, waist circumference ≥90 cm for men and ≥ 80 cm for women
  2. High blood pressure, systolic blood pressure ≥130 mmHg and/or diastolic blood pressure ≥85 mmHg and/or medication for hypertension
  3. High fasting plasma glucose, fasting plasma glucose ≥100 mg/dl; high triglycerides, triglycerides ≥150 mg/dl; Low HDL-C, HDL cholesterol <40 mg/dl for men and <50 mg/dl for women
